Indian Rupee Gains In Early Trade As Dollar Weakens Marginally

After opening at 64.80 to the dollar, the Indian rupee gained marginally in early trade on Tuesday after the dollar index pared some of its gains from the previous session.

At 0936 IST, the rupee was trading at 64.77 to the dollar, 0.2 percent stronger than its previous close. The rupee is expected to weaken during Tuesday’s session as the dollar is likely to gain in markets across the globe, dealers said.

“The spectre of further US rate hikes has put EM currencies under limelight. USD-INR is expected to trade within 64.75-65 range for today,” said Bhaskar Panda of HDFC Bank.
